sequência de Power-Up para um motorista de ônibus
A figura a seguir mostra a ordem na qual a estrutura chama as funções de retorno de chamada de evento de um driver de barramento KMDF ao trazer um dispositivo para o estado totalmente operacional, começando pelo estado Device Inserted na parte inferior da figura:
A estrutura não exclui fisicamente um PDO até que o dispositivo correspondente seja fisicamente removido do sistema. Por exemplo, se um usuário desabilitar o dispositivo em Gerenciador de Dispositivos mas não o remover fisicamente, a estrutura manterá seu objeto de dispositivo. Portanto, as três etapas na parte inferior da figura ocorrem somente durante Plug and Play enumeração , ou seja, durante a inicialização inicial ou quando o usuário insere um novo dispositivo. Se o dispositivo foi desabilitado anteriormente, mas não foi fisicamente removido, a estrutura começa chamando o retorno de chamada EvtDevicePrepareHardware .